How Can I Optimize an E-Commerce Site for Speed? #
Speed is crucial for e-commerce sites. A fast site improves user experience and boosts conversions. It also supports SEO and reduces bounce rates. In this guide, we cover actionable steps to optimize your e-commerce site for speed.
1. Choose a Reliable Hosting Provider #
A strong hosting provider forms the backbone of a fast site. Select a host that offers robust security and speed. Look for features like SSD storage and server-level caching. Reliable hosts also offer automated backups and support.
Key Points:
- Use managed WordPress hosting if available.
- Opt for cloud or VPS hosting instead of shared hosting.
- Choose a provider with a good reputation for uptime.
A good host ensures fast server response times and reliable performance.
2. Optimize Your Images #
Large images slow down load times significantly. Compress images without losing quality. Use modern formats like WebP for better compression. Resize images to fit your design instead of using full-size files.
Image Optimization Tips:
- Use plugins such as Smush or Imagify.
- Enable lazy loading to load images only when needed.
- Optimize images before uploading them to your site.
These steps reduce page weight and enhance speed.
3. Implement Caching #
Caching stores a static version of your site, reducing load times. Use a caching plugin to create fast-loading pages. Caching decreases server load and speeds up repeated visits.
Popular Caching Plugins:
- WP Rocket
- W3 Total Cache
- WP Super Cache
In addition, enable browser caching to store resources on the visitor’s device. This practice improves repeat visit performance.
4. Use a Content Delivery Network (CDN) #
A CDN distributes your site’s content worldwide. It delivers files from servers closest to your visitors. This reduces latency and speeds up page loads. Popular CDN providers include Cloudflare, BunnyCDN, and KeyCDN.
Benefits of a CDN:
- Faster delivery of static files.
- Reduced load on your origin server.
- Improved security features like DDoS protection.
A CDN is a cost-effective way to boost performance globally.
5. Minimize HTTP Requests and Code #
Reducing HTTP requests can greatly enhance load speed. Combine CSS and JavaScript files where possible. Minify your code to remove unnecessary spaces and comments. Defer non-critical JavaScript to load after the main content.
Optimization Techniques:
- Use tools like Autoptimize or WP Rocket.
- Remove unused plugins and scripts.
- Optimize CSS delivery by loading critical styles first.
Simplifying your code improves efficiency and speeds up your site.
6. Optimize Your Database #
A cluttered database can slow down your site. Clean up your database regularly by removing unnecessary data. Optimize database tables to enhance performance. Use plugins like WP-Optimize to automate these tasks.
Database Tips:
- Delete post revisions and spam comments.
- Optimize tables on a regular schedule.
- Consider moving large datasets to external storage if needed.
A lean database speeds up query responses and overall site performance.
7. Enhance Mobile Performance #
Mobile users often experience slower connections. Ensure your site is mobile-friendly by using responsive design. Optimize all elements for various screen sizes. Test your site on multiple devices to guarantee smooth performance.
Mobile Optimization Steps:
- Use a responsive theme.
- Optimize images and media for mobile.
- Use tools like Google’s Mobile-Friendly Test to check performance.
Mobile optimization is crucial as many users shop using smartphones and tablets.
8. Monitor and Test Regularly #
Continuous monitoring helps you catch issues early. Use tools like Google PageSpeed Insights, GTmetrix, or Pingdom. Test your site’s speed after each update. Regular audits help maintain optimal performance.
Monitoring Tips:
- Set up automated performance reports.
- Analyze page load times regularly.
- Adjust strategies based on data insights.
This proactive approach ensures your site remains fast and competitive.
Final Thoughts #
Optimizing an e-commerce site for speed involves multiple strategies. Start with reliable hosting, optimize images, and implement caching and a CDN. Minimize code, optimize your database, and ensure mobile performance. Regular testing and monitoring are also essential.
By following these steps, you enhance user experience, improve SEO, and boost conversions. For further assistance with optimizing your e-commerce site, email Ikonik Digital at [email protected] for expert support.